High-tension Wire Kills Electrician In Lagos On New Year Day

An electrician, simply identified as Sheni was, on January 1, electrocuted by a high-tension wire at UNILAG Estate, Magodo area of Lagos State.
The deceased was said to have been contracted by a resident of the estate to make some wiring connections on the electricity pole when the unexpected tragedy occured.
A resident, who spoke on condition of anonymity, stated, “He was not a staff member of any electricity distribution company, and the wiring repairs were done without the involvement of the electricity distribution company.”
A team from the Anti-Crime Patrol at Isheri Division, fire service personnel, and the Lagos State Ambulance Services visited the scene. Sheni was reportedly confirmed dead after his body was brought down from the pole.
His body was subsequently taken to the mortuary, while efforts are ongoing to locate his relatives.
